1. Affordability
The purchase of a couch can be expensive, but furniture stores frequently offer discounts and sales. NerdWallet suggests shopping for couches during these times to find the most affordable prices and to avoid spending too much.
Another way to save money is to look for a used couch. Although you won't be able to customize this type of sofa, it's much more affordable than purchasing an entirely new one. You can find deals at local yard sales and flea markets, as well as on the online marketplaces of major furniture retailers.
When you are looking for a couch, consider the frame's quality. The cheapest options will use mesh or webbing, while better couches have a kiln-dried hardwood frame, such as beech or oak. The springs of couches sale also come in various quality levels. Cheaper ones don't have any springs whatsoever, whereas the more expensive ones may include serpentine springs or eight-way hand-tied springs.

4. Sustainability in the Environment
Fast fashion is a trend that sustainability experts have long warned against. However, it's important to think about the environmental impact of large furniture items like leather couches for sale that will be thrown out. A couch made from sustainable materials by a local manufacturer will likely leave a less carbon footprint than a couch imported from abroad.
Aside from the type of material used in a couch, the process of manufacturing is an important factor to consider when determining the eco-friendliness of any particular sofa. Does the company make use of renewable energy sources during production? Does it use recycled materials to reduce waste? What are the processes that the manufacturing facilities it operates run in terms of conserving natural resources and reducing pollution?
To cut down on the amount of new furniture that ends up in landfills try looking for a sustainable couch for sale from a secondhand or vintage seller. Many of these sellers provide professional cleaning and repairs to prolong the lifespan of furniture and prevent it from being thrown away in the garbage. Check out the offerings at Kaiyo an online marketplace that sells and buys used furniture to keep it from being thrown away.
For a more sustainable option, look for a couch made from organic fabrics or sustainably sourced woods. VivaTerra, for example, creates couches in the USA using wood sourced ethically and organic cotton or hemp certified by GOTS. Their foam is Cradle To Cradle certified and they don't use any flame retardants or formaldehyde in their cushions. They also ship sofas in 100% recyclable corrugated boxes and offset their carbon emissions for the entire year.
There are also companies like Maiden Home, which crafts their black couches for sale to order in order to cut down on waste and create them locally in North Carolina. They make use of recycled and reused materials, including upcycled velvet and polyester, both of which have OEKO-TEX and GRS certifications.
